Ticket: Drift detected in Gauntlens GPU profiling agents. Flagging for the weekly sync: the memory-sampling agents on the Corvane training pods are running with three different sampling intervals and inconsistent allocator-hook settings, so cross-pod fragmentation reports are not comparable this sprint. Root cause appears to be a half-applied rollout from two weeks ago. We propose freezing changes until everyone confirms the baseline. The intended canonical configuration is reproduced below.

settings of fafog-haduf:
ZORIX_PIN=4648
ZORIX_METRICS_HOST=metrics.zorix.paliqsys.corp
ZORIX_LOG_LEVEL=info
ZORIX_TENANT=druix

## Ownership

Welcome aboard! The waveform preview module (the little squiggly renderer you see in Trillcast's clip editor) lives in `audio/preview/`. It generates peak data server-side and draws the canvas client-side, so bugs can hide on either end. Don't refactor the downsampling logic without a heads-up — it's tuned for long podcast files. If anything looks off or you want context on past decisions, reach out to the module owner.

account owner for bawip-tahag: Raleth Quenok

Artifact Signing: Payment Retry Service. Quick note for the release manager: the Tollgate retry service stamps every payment attempt with an idempotency key so a retried charge can't double-bill. Those keys are generated inside the signed artifact, which means an unsigned build will mint colliding keys — bad times. So always verify the build before promotion. The verification step expects the signing key shown directly below this paragraph.

signing key of hahag-tahag = bky4_v18e

Hey, welcome to on-call for Ledgerline! Quick context: the events table is partitioned by month, and a cron job creates next month's partition on the 25th. When that job fails (it happens), inserts start erroring right at midnight on the 1st — fun times. The runbook has the manual `CREATE PARTITION` steps. To run them, you'll connect to the primary with the connection string below.

database URL for hafog-yahip: clickhouse://rusir_svc:LpcRMav@db-3230.norvaforge.example:5432/gorir